There’s a setup problem I run into constantly on commercial jobs: the client wants drama, the budget allows for maybe a half-day studio rental, and I need to build a look that feels expensive without stacking up eight light heads and a crew of three assistants. The answer, almost every time, is learning to do more with less. Colored rim lights, a tight modifier on the key, and a reflector you found leaning against the wall. That’s not compromise. That’s control.

The finished portrait is a moody, blue-drenched image with a subject who looks sculpted by light rather than just illuminated by it. Three lights and a piece of bead board got him there. Here’s how it works.
Step 1: Choose a Color Direction and Commit to It
Two rim lights positioned on either side of subject
Morgan starts with two lights placed at the back on either side of the subject, both fitted with modifiers that throw a cyan-tinted output. The color he uses is described as a “cyan 60,” which functions roughly like a CTB (color temperature blue) gel pushed toward the cooler, more saturated end of the spectrum. These are rim lights, positioned to wrap a band of color around the edges of the subject’s shoulders and head.
What I find instructive here is the decision-making process. He initially had a red background light in the mix. The red wasn’t working because the blue from the rims was spilling onto the background and muddying the color relationship. Rather than fight it, he pulled the red, let the blue rims do everything, and discovered the all-blue look was stronger. The lesson: when you introduce color, let one hue dominate. Competing colors rarely read as “complex.” They just read as dirty.
Step 2: Position the Rims for a Double-Rim Effect

A double rim means you have a light source on each side of the subject from behind, both aimed toward the camera. These are not at 45 degrees from behind. They’re closer to the 90-to-120-degree range, placed well behind the subject’s plane and angled forward. The goal is to trace the edge of the body with color, not to fill the face.
Feathering matters here. You want the light to catch the shoulder, the jaw, the ear. If the rim bleeds too far forward onto the cheek or forehead, it starts competing with your key. Keep it tight to the edge. Morgan’s blue rims produce a clean separation between the subject and the background without any additional background light needed, because the spill from the rims is doing that ambient work on its own.
Step 3: Build the Key Light Around a Snoot and a Grid

The key light in this setup is intentionally understated. Morgan uses a snoot combined with a 20-degree grid and wraps black wrap tightly around the modifier to further restrict the spread of light. The result is a narrow, concentrated beam that lands primarily on the subject’s face without spilling onto the background or washing out the color from the rims.
This is a setup I’ve used for beauty work when the art director wants “luminous but dark.” The grid kills the scatter. The black wrap kills whatever the grid missed. What arrives on the subject’s skin is clean, directional light that reads as a soft glow rather than a hard flash. The power level is also kept low here deliberately. You’re not trying to overpower the rims. You’re trying to open the shadows on the face just enough that the subject doesn’t disappear into the dark.
Step 4: Add a Foam Board Reflector for Subtle Fill

The final piece of the setup is the simplest: a piece of white bead board (foam core) placed low and in front of the subject. It catches the spill from the key light and bounces it upward into the underside of the jaw and chin. No power setting. No modifier. Just a reflector positioned to recycle light that would otherwise hit the floor and disappear.
I keep a few pieces of foam core in every size leaning against the wall of my studio, labeled by size because yes, I label everything in there. The 24x36 piece gets used on almost every headshot job I book. The cost is zero. The effect on the catchlights and the under-chin shadows is noticeable every single time. Don’t underestimate a reflector just because it doesn’t plug in.
Step 5: Set Your Camera for the Low-Light Environment

For the portrait portion of the shoot, Morgan is working with a relatively low ISO (100), an aperture of f/5.6, and a 90mm lens. The 90mm focal length is doing the flattering compression work you’d expect from a portrait-length lens, keeping the face proportional and the background reasonably blurred without going so long that you’re fighting the framing.
The exposure settings reflect the fact that this is a strobe-driven setup in a dark room. The ambient is not contributing meaningfully to the exposure. The strobes are doing all the work. That’s worth noting: in a setup like this, your shutter speed (within sync range) doesn’t affect exposure the way it would outdoors. What you’re controlling is the flash power, the subject-to-light distance, and the aperture. ISO stays low. Shutter stays at or below your sync speed.
What I’d Do Differently on a Commercial Job
The color gels Morgan uses are a fairly saturated cyan, which reads beautifully on video and editorial. For a fashion or beauty client, I’d test a slightly more restrained blue before committing. Full-saturation cyan can be unforgiving on certain skin tones and sometimes needs to be walked back in post anyway.
I’d also sketch this setup before the shoot. I keep a lighting journal, and when I look back at past jobs, some of my most efficient studio days came from arriving with a diagram already on paper and knowing exactly where the first light goes. Setups like this one, rim-heavy with a tight key, can fall apart quickly if the rims are too powerful relative to the key. Dialing it in before you have a paid subject sitting in the chair saves everyone time.
The single most important takeaway from this tutorial is that restraint produces mood. Every decision Morgan makes here is about containing the light: a snooted key, a tight grid, black wrap, low power, a reflector instead of a fourth light. More light sources do not automatically mean a better portrait. The best portrait lighting is the minimum light required to tell the story you want to tell.
